The Hotelboat Allure is an excellent place to stay in Amsterdam if you want to be close to the city and have an enjoyable, unique hotel experience. We were able to easily walk to the dock from the train station with our luggage. With it being docked in a central location, we had no trouble finding the boat. Once we arrived, Kris carried our luggage up the gangway, showed us to our room, and gave us a description of the basic amenities he had available. Our room was one of ten and was small but functional with a comfortable, clean bed and it's own private bathroom. In the main dining area there is always coffee and tea available with fresh fruit, cold pop and water, and often other goodies. Kris cooked breakfasts are prepared from early in the morning and catered to individual needs and requests. Food was varied, fresh and tasty. Kris was always around to visit with guests, answer questions, maintain a tidy welcoming atmosphere, and generally ensure we enjoyed our visit. We would definitely stay here again as it was a great way to meet people from all over the world who were into staying in a fun, different type of accommodation.
